2009-11-22 12 views
13

एनएसईआरआरओआर को एक डोमेन की आवश्यकता होती है, जिसे मैं त्रुटि कोड की सीमा को समझता हूं।एनएसईआरआर डोमेन/कस्टम डोमेन - सम्मेलन और सर्वोत्तम प्रथाओं

कोई यह अनुमान लगाएगा कि डोमेन की कहीं रजिस्ट्री मौजूद है। आतंक कोड लेकिन मैं एक को खोजने में सक्षम नहीं हूं।

माना जाता है कि यह त्रुटियों के लिए स्थानीय विवरण देखने के लिए उपयोग किया जा सकता है।

क्या किसी के पास त्रुटि डोमेन और कोड से निपटने के लिए ज्ञात सर्वोत्तम प्रथाओं का कोई सेट है? एक आधिकारिक संदर्भ (प्रमुख डेवलपर्स या ढांचा निर्माता) इष्टतम है, लेकिन यहां तक ​​कि एक अच्छा सम्मेलन का विवरण देने वाले ब्लॉग भी उपयोगी हैं।

अपनी परियोजनाओं में आप अपने त्रुटि डोमेन/कोड के रजिस्ट्रियां बनाए रखते हैं जो स्थानीयकृत विवरण, पुनर्प्राप्ति, अच्छी तरह से ज्ञात userinfo कुंजी या डोमेन/कोड के आधार पर आपकी त्रुटि वस्तुओं के लिए कारखानों की तरह मानचित्रण करते हैं?

या आप आम तौर पर कुछ डोमेन और कुछ कोड को एक साथ जोड़ते हैं, और अपने bespoke एनएसईआरआर डोमेन में अच्छी तरह से ज्ञात userinfo कुंजी जैसे NSLocalizedDescriptionKey, आदि पर निर्भर करते हैं?

उत्तर

13

ऐप्पल आम तौर पर फ्रेमवर्कनाम नामक हेडर नामक शीर्षलेख में अपने एनएस/सीएफईआरआर कोड प्रकाशित करता है। उदाहरण के लिए, फाउंडेशन के त्रुटि कोड फाउंडेशन/FoundationErrors.h में हैं। इसके अतिरिक्त, वे आम तौर पर ढांचे के लिए अपने दस्तावेज़ों में डोमेन और कोड प्रकाशित करते हैं।

अपने स्वयं के त्रुटि डोमेन और कोड के साथ एक ढांचे के किसी भी स्वतंत्र लेखक को वही करना चाहिए।